Then they came to a place which was named Gethsemane; and He said to His disciples, "Sit here while I pray.“ And He took Peter, James, and John with Him, and He began to be troubled and deeply distressed. Then He said to them, "My soul is exceedingly sorrowful, even to death. Stay here and watch." He went a little farther, and fell on the ground, and prayed that if it were possible, the hour might pass from Him. And He said, "Abba, Father, all things are possible for You. Take this cup away from Me; nevertheless, not what I will, but what You will.“ Mark 14:32-36 (NKJ)

  3. Then He came and found them sleeping, and said to Peter, "Simon, are you sleeping? Could you not watch one hour? Watch and pray, lest you enter into temptation. The spirit indeed is willing, but the flesh is weak.“ Again He went away and prayed, and spoke the same words. And when He returned, He found them asleep again, for their eyes were heavy; and they did not know what to answer Him. Then He came the third time and said to them, "Are you still sleeping and resting? It is enough! The hour has come; behold, the Son of Man is being betrayed into the hands of sinners. Rise, let us be going. See, My betrayer is at hand.“ Mk. 14:37- 42 (NKJ)

  4. Prayer Mk. 14:32-42 • Be Consistent

  5. Coming out, He went to the Mount of Olives, as He was accustomed, and His disciples also followed Him. Luke 22:39 (NKJ)

  6. And Judas, who betrayed Him, also knew the place; for Jesus often met there with His disciples. John 18:2 (NKJ)

  7. So He Himself often withdrew into the wilderness and prayed. Lk. 5:16 (NKJ)

  8. Prayer Mk. 14:32-42 • Be Consistent • Be Emotional

  9. And being in agony, He prayed more earnestly. Then His sweat became like great drops of blood falling down to the ground. Lk. 22:44 (NKJ)

  10. Likewise the Spirit also helps in our weaknesses. For we do not know what we should pray for as we ought, but the Spirit Himself makes intercession for us with groanings which cannot be uttered. Now He who searches the hearts knows what the mind of the Spirit is, because He makes intercession for the saints according to the will of God. Romans 8:26-27 (NKJ)

  11. Prayer Mk. 14:32-42 • Be Consistent • Be Emotional • Be Short & Simple

  12. So He said to them, "When you pray, say: Our Father in heaven, Hallowed be Your name. Your kingdom come. Your will be done On earth as it is in heaven. Give us day by day our daily bread. And forgive us our sins, For we also forgive everyone who is indebted to us. And do not lead us into temptation, But deliver us from the evil one." Luke 11:2-4 (NKJ)

  13. Prayer Mk. 14:32-42 • Be Consistent • Be Emotional • Be Short & Simple • Be Obedient

  14. And whatever you ask in My name, that I will do, that the Father may be glorified in the Son. If you ask anything in My name, I will do it. If you love Me, keep My commandments. John 14:13-15(NKJ)

  15. Prayer Mk. 14:32-42 • Be Consistent • Be Emotional • Be Short & Simple • Be Obedient • Be Persistent

  16. Then He spoke a parable to them, that men always ought to pray and not lose heart, saying: "There was in a certain city a judge who did not fear God nor regard man. Now there was a widow in that city; and she came to him, saying, "Get justice for me from my adversary.‘ And he would not for a while; but afterward he said within himself, "Though I do not fear God nor regard man, yet because this widow troubles me I will avenge her, lest by her continual coming she weary me."‘ Luke 18:1-5 (NKJ)
